Transaction 3b4b7b15e5745022a32300baa90d4d156bc589efd2e956360643769d2bd2a87b
2 Input
2 Outputs
- 3b4b7b15e5745022a32300baa90d4d156bc589efd2e956360643769d2bd2a87b:0
- 3b4b7b15e5745022a32300baa90d4d156bc589efd2e956360643769d2bd2a87b:1
value 8803928
address 1DZZg7m62jRcgf4ytjLPuCUGVhBpR49G5T
value 23027983
address 1EyPKTBp8bL46zb2JgNpcjSLvBo5jeHc7S